Wonderpark was a family entertainment center located in Cincinnati, Ohio, USA. It opened on December 15, 2001 and closed in March 2008.

Fate

After Wonderpark's closure, the space it was in has since been used for a bounce house place called B Adventurous. The wall paintings from Wonderpark are still intact even after almost twenty years.[2]
